Best Schools in Alachua, FL
Alachua, FL has a total of 12 schools including 3 high schools, 4 middle schools and 5 elementary schools. A total of 5,662 students attend Alachua, FL schools. On average, schools in Alachua score 56% on their proficiency tests, and we project an average score of 45% on those same proficiency tests. Comparing the differences, on average, schools in Alachua greatly exceed expectations.

Education & Community Snapshot in Alachua, FL
City-level factors that shape the learning environment around local schools.
Community Factors
Alachua, FL has a total population of 16,005 with 26% of that population attending schools. The adult high school graduation rate is 95%, and 40% of adults have a bachelor’s degree or higher.
